The Indonesia Industrial Pulley Market was estimated at USD 220 Million in 2025 and is projected to reach USD 291 Million by 2032, growing at a CAGR of 4.1% from 2026 to 2032. This growth is driven by the increasing demand across key sectors such as mining, construction, and manufacturing, where pulleys play an essential role in power transmission. Furthermore, the rise of energy-efficient technologies and the expansion of the automotive industry, fueled by an emerging middle class, are likely to sustain the upward trajectory of this market.

The industrial pulley sector in Indonesia is witnessing a transformation fueled by advancements in technology and the growing demand for efficient machinery. As industries such as mining and construction ramp up operations, the necessity for reliable power transmission components like pulleys has never been greater.
A burgeoning middle class is propelling the automotive sector, which in turn increases demand for industrial pulleys in the production of related machinery. Moreover, local raw material availability and a competitive labor force are likely to enhance the markets growth prospects.
Despite positive growth projections, the industrial pulley market in Indonesia faces several restraints that could impede its advancement. One significant issue is the demand for lightweight and durable materials, which can challenge traditional manufacturing processes. Quality control remains a concern, especially as competition intensifies from alternative power transmission technologies, such as direct drives and servo systems. Additionally, potential project delays caused by external factors may lead to fluctuations in market demand, hindering steady growth.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
